Amyloidosis Treatment: Understanding Your Options
Amyloidosis is a rare and complex disease that requires specialized medical care. This condition occurs when abnormal proteins called amyloids build up in various organs and tissues, potentially causing serious health complications. If you or a loved one has been diagnosed with amyloidosis, understanding the available treatment options is crucial for managing the disease effectively and improving quality of life.
What are the main types of amyloidosis treatment?
Treatment for amyloidosis varies depending on the specific type of the disease and the organs affected. The primary goal of treatment is to slow or stop the production of amyloid proteins, manage symptoms, and support organ function. Some of the main treatment approaches include:
-
Chemotherapy: Used to target and destroy the cells producing abnormal proteins.
-
Stem cell transplantation: A procedure that replaces damaged bone marrow with healthy stem cells.
-
Targeted therapies: Medications that specifically inhibit the production of amyloid proteins.
-
Organ transplantation: In severe cases, transplanting affected organs may be necessary.
-
Supportive care: Treatments to manage symptoms and improve quality of life.
How do doctors diagnose and monitor amyloidosis?
Diagnosing amyloidosis can be challenging due to its rarity and the similarity of its symptoms to other conditions. Doctors typically use a combination of medical history, physical examination, and various diagnostic tests to confirm the presence of amyloidosis and determine its type. These tests may include:
-
Blood and urine tests to detect abnormal proteins
-
Tissue biopsies to identify amyloid deposits
-
Imaging studies such as echocardiograms or MRIs to assess organ involvement
-
Genetic testing to identify hereditary forms of the disease
Once diagnosed, patients require ongoing monitoring to assess the effectiveness of treatment and detect any disease progression or complications.

What are the latest advancements in amyloidosis treatment?
Recent years have seen significant progress in the treatment of amyloidosis, offering new hope for patients. Some of the latest advancements include:
-
Gene silencing therapies that target the root cause of certain types of amyloidosis
-
Novel targeted therapies that specifically inhibit amyloid protein production
-
Improved diagnostic techniques for earlier and more accurate detection
-
Combination therapies that enhance treatment effectiveness
-
Personalized medicine approaches tailored to individual patient profiles
